A distinguished 19th-century château, constructed in 1800 on the foundations of a 14th-century manor, is set within a sprawling 71-acre estate in South Touraine, France. This property features a serene lake and extensive woodlands, providing a private retreat with convenient access to local amenities and the city of Tours, approximately one hour's drive away. The château, characterized by its elegant three-storey structure, boasts a grand entrance hall with an oak staircase, a library, three spacious reception rooms, and a professional kitchen with access to an independent two-storey apartment. The first floor accommodates eight bedrooms, complemented by six bathrooms and a small kitchen. The second floor includes a studio apartment and an additional six bedrooms, each with en-suite facilities, along with four more bedrooms and two bathrooms located in the upper floor of the tower. The estate features two refurbished two-storey outbuildings, which house a computer workroom, classrooms, a consecrated chapel, and seminar facilities. Additional outbuildings include a laundry, archives, a boiler room, and a tractor hangar. A circular pigeonnier graces the southern grounds, while the northern side features the "Lake House," equipped with a licensed bar and lounges, along with accommodation above. There is also potential for the creation of a larger chapel-style building on the estate. The estate encompasses approximately half forested land, providing scenic walking paths and a sustainable supply of wood for heating. A picturesque lake, approximately 1.2 hectares in size, is located behind the Lake House, home to swans and an island. The property also includes an 8x4 meter swimming pool situated conveniently behind the château.
